A few updates from our meeting with the club today.

There are roughly 18,000 people on the Champions League scheme.

We will be purchasing our tickets directly from UEFA - not City. As someone else mentioned, all tickets will be mobile on the UEFA app.

In order to buy tickets, supporters will be given an access code. The club can distribute codes that only grant access at a certain time, so that we are still able to stagger sales to cup scheme members and different point levels.

We have asked the club to require supporters make an expression of interest to receive a code. This would like be done on our normal ticketing platform. The alternative would be providing every single cup scheme member, then potentially all season card holders and even a large number of Cityzens with a code. So, it should make things a bit more manageable and we are liaising with the club over potential accessibility issues to the site and tickets.

18-25 and Junior Pull through will be available and will likely also require an EOI.

As far as I am aware, UEFA will not allow supporters to choose their specific seat. Only the category.
